Re: [opensuse-virtual] @ 11.3 xen Dom0 boot, "microcode: error! Wrong microcode patch file"
reply-all didn't get this to list ... posting. On Fri, Jul 9, 2010 at 8:15 AM, 0bo0 <0.bugs.only.0@gmail.com> wrote:
On Fri, Jul 9, 2010 at 12:46 AM, Jan Beulich <JBeulich@novell.com> wrote:
The question then is why request_firmware() succeeds. We're not talking about a kernel you built yourself, do we?
no, not custom. atm, this is,
uname -a Linux server 2.6.34.1-2-xen #1 SMP 2010-07-06 15:11:07 +0200 x86_64 x86_64 x86_64 GNU/Linux lsb_release -a LSB Version: core-2.0-noarch:core-3.2-noarch:core-4.0-noarch:core-2.0-x86_64:core-3.2-x86_64:core-4.0-x86_64:desktop-4.0-amd64:desktop-4.0-noarch:graphics-2.0-amd64:graphics-2.0-noarch:graphics-3.2-amd64:graphics-3.2-noarch:graphics-4.0-amd64:graphics-4.0-noarch Distributor ID: SUSE LINUX Description: openSUSE 11.3 (x86_64) Release: 11.3 Codename: n/a grep base /etc/zypp/repos.d/Kernel_113.repo baseurl=http://download.opensuse.org/repositories/Kernel:/openSUSE-11.3/openSUSE_11....
Again, this is a different thing. Can we please finally get to know how a native kernel of the same version behaves?
You may want to set udev_log="info" in /etc/udev/udev.conf and USE_SYSLOG="yes" in /etc/sysconfig/hardware/config to get relevant output from /lib/udev/firmware.sh.
You may want to set udev_log="info" in /etc/udev/udev.conf and USE_SYSLOG="yes" in /etc/sysconfig/hardware/config to get
mkdir -p /etc/sysconfig/hardware
udev_log="info" < -- /etc/udev/udev.conf USE_SYSLOG="yes" <-- /etc/sysconfig/hardware/config to get
reboot uname -a Linux server 2.6.34.1-2-default #1 SMP 2010-07-06 15:11:07 +0200 x86_64 x86_64 x86_64 GNU/Linux
egrep -i "amd|microcode" /var/log/* boot.msg:<6>[ 0.000000] RAMDISK: 374ec000 - 37ff0000 boot.msg:<4>[ 0.000000] ACPI: SSDT 00000000cff87950 0088C (v01 A M I POWERNOW 00000001 AMD 00000001) boot.msg:<6>[ 0.000000] #2 [00374ec000 - 0037ff0000] RAMDISK boot.msg:<6>[ 0.108011] Performance Events: AMD PMU driver. boot.msg:<6>[ 0.389812] CPU0: AMD Phenom(tm) II X4 920 Processor stepping 02 boot.msg:<6>[ 6.049868] ehci_hcd 0000:00:12.2: applying AMD SB600/SB700 USB freeze workaround boot.msg:<6>[ 6.410466] ehci_hcd 0000:00:13.2: applying AMD SB600/SB700 USB freeze workaround boot.msg:<6>[ 70.960588] EDAC amd64_edac: Ver: 3.3.0 Jul 7 2010 boot.msg:<5>[ 70.972413] EDAC amd64: This node reports that Memory ECC is currently disabled, set F3x44[22] (0000:00:18.3). boot.msg:<5>[ 70.995125] EDAC amd64: ECC disabled in the BIOS or no ECC capability, module will not load. boot.msg:<4>[ 71.052063] amd64_edac: probe of 0000:00:18.2 failed with error -22 boot.msg:<6>[ 101.168845] microcode: CPU0: patch_level=0x1000086 boot.msg:<6>[ 101.179148] platform microcode: firmware: requesting amd-ucode/microcode_amd.bin boot.msg:<3>[ 161.196043] microcode: failed to load file amd-ucode/microcode_amd.bin boot.msg:<6>[ 161.209155] microcode: CPU1: patch_level=0x1000086 boot.msg:<6>[ 161.218814] platform microcode: firmware: requesting amd-ucode/microcode_amd.bin boot.msg:<3>[ 183.217466] microcode: failed to load file amd-ucode/microcode_amd.bin boot.msg:<6>[ 183.231803] microcode: CPU2: patch_level=0x1000086 boot.msg:<6>[ 183.244129] platform microcode: firmware: requesting amd-ucode/microcode_amd.bin boot.msg:<3>[ 183.947110] microcode: failed to load file amd-ucode/microcode_amd.bin boot.msg:<6>[ 183.960985] microcode: CPU3: patch_level=0x1000086 boot.msg:<6>[ 183.973330] platform microcode: firmware: requesting amd-ucode/microcode_amd.bin boot.msg:<3>[ 184.714601] microcode: failed to load file amd-ucode/microcode_amd.bin boot.msg:<6>[ 184.729013] microcode: Microcode Update Driver: v2.00 <tigran@aivazian.fsnet.co.uk>, Peter Oruba boot.msg:<6>[ 184.736631] microcode: AMD microcode update via /dev/cpu/microcode not supported boot.msg:<6>[ 184.736649] microcode: AMD microcode update via /dev/cpu/microcode not supported boot.msg:<6>[ 184.784460] microcode: AMD microcode update via /dev/cpu/microcode not supported boot.msg:<6>[ 184.833775] microcode: AMD microcode update via /dev/cpu/microcode not supported boot.msg:<6>[ 184.870692] microcode: AMD microcode update via /dev/cpu/microcode not supported boot.msg:<6>[ 185.577429] microcode: AMD microcode update via /dev/cpu/microcode not supported boot.msg:<6>[ 186.324561] microcode: AMD microcode update via /dev/cpu/microcode not supported boot.msg:udevd[851]: reading '/lib/udev/rules.d/89-microcode.rules' as rules file boot.msg:udevadm[853]: device 0x622140 has devpath '/bus/pci/drivers/agpgart-amd64' boot.msg:device 0x622140 has devpath '/bus/pci/drivers/agpgart-amd64' boot.msg:udevd[852]: mknod '/dev/cpu/microcode' c10:184 boot.msg:udevd-work[854]: device 0x621e00 has devpath '/bus/pci/drivers/agpgart-amd64' messages:Jul 9 07:58:02 server kernel: [ 256.426728] powernow-k8: Found 1 AMD Phenom(tm) II X4 920 Processor (4 cpu cores) (version 2.20.00) messages:Jul 9 07:58:03 server udevadm[3583]: device 0x622140 has devpath '/devices/platform/microcode' messages:Jul 9 07:58:03 server udevadm[3583]: device 0x6221c0 has devpath '/devices/virtual/misc/microcode' messages:Jul 9 07:58:03 server udevadm[3583]: device 0x63fc10 has devpath '/devices/platform/microcode' messages:Jul 9 07:58:03 server udevadm[3583]: device 0x63fc90 has devpath '/devices/virtual/misc/microcode' messages:Jul 9 07:58:03 server udevadm[3583]: device 0x63fc90 filled with db symlink data '/dev/cpu/microcode' messages:Jul 9 07:58:03 server udevadm[3583]: device 0x63fc90 filled with db symlink data '/dev/cpu/microcode' messages:Jul 9 07:58:03 server udevadm[3583]: device 0x63fc90 filled with db symlink data '/dev/cpu/microcode' messages:Jul 9 07:58:03 server udevadm[3583]: device 0x63fc90 filled with db symlink data '/dev/cpu/microcode' messages:Jul 9 07:58:03 server udevadm[3583]: device 0x63fc90 filled with db symlink data '/dev/cpu/microcode' messages:Jul 9 07:58:11 server udevadm[4195]: device 0x622140 has devpath '/devices/platform/microcode' messages:Jul 9 07:58:11 server udevadm[4195]: device 0x6221c0 has devpath '/devices/virtual/misc/microcode' messages:Jul 9 07:58:11 server udevadm[4195]: device 0x6402f0 has devpath '/devices/platform/microcode' messages:Jul 9 07:58:11 server udevadm[4195]: device 0x640370 has devpath '/devices/virtual/misc/microcode' messages:Jul 9 07:58:11 server udevadm[4195]: device 0x640370 filled with db symlink data '/dev/cpu/microcode' messages:Jul 9 07:58:11 server udevadm[4195]: device 0x640370 filled with db symlink data '/dev/cpu/microcode' messages:Jul 9 07:58:11 server udevadm[4195]: device 0x640370 filled with db symlink data '/dev/cpu/microcode' messages:Jul 9 07:58:11 server udevadm[4195]: device 0x640370 filled with db symlink data '/dev/cpu/microcode' messages:Jul 9 07:58:11 server udevadm[4195]: device 0x640370 filled with db symlink data '/dev/cpu/microcode'
if you want udev_log -> debug level, or other, output, happy to provide it.
-- To unsubscribe, e-mail: opensuse-virtual+unsubscribe@opensuse.org For additional commands, e-mail: opensuse-virtual+help@opensuse.org
participants (1)
-
0bo0